An area drained by a single
An area drained by a single river system. All the water from rainfall and streams in this area flows into one main river.
An elevated area like a mountain
An elevated area like a mountain or upland that separates two drainage basins, directing water flow in different directions.

Rivers of the peninsular plateau
Rivers of the peninsular plateau, mostly seasonal, with shorter and shallower courses compared to Himalayan rivers.
Contamination of rivers due to domestic
Contamination of rivers due to domestic sewage, industrial effluents, and agricultural runoff, affecting water quality and ecosystem.
